Transaction 62a5b3b3054c282cc5edb1141a6731a59c588ebe175b5696ea1cd03aeb12d816
1 Input
1 Output
-
62a5b3b3054c282cc5edb1141a6731a59c588ebe175b5696ea1cd03aeb12d816:0
- value
- 1233503
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d725d7e83cf891f762160cd42d7065eb2b4c984 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16buDwHGvScCBkDbe2WJYjF14X4qULhjh7